Tigers, Bulldogs advance wrestlers to regionals
Bendle’s Kyle Leonard placed second at 112 lbs. at Mayville last Saturday.
File Photo MAYVILLE — The Bendle and Bentley wrestling teams participated in the Div. 4 individual wrestling district at Mayville last Saturday.
Bendle had three qualifiers led by Kyle Leonard’s second-place finish at 112 lbs. Leonard pinned Jackson Demmon from Sandusky in 3:21 and fell to Marlette’s Andy Bowman in the finals by fall.
Jacob Low took third at 130 by defeating Kyle Giddings of Mayville, 19-4, losing to Marlette’s Nate Byrnes, 8-6, pinning Cass City’s Blake Lebioda in 4:55 and pinning Mayville’s Kyle Baxter in 4:41.
Jacob McDaniel was the final qualifier for the Tigers with a fourth-place finish. McDaniel lost to Valley Lutheran’s Jacob Kaufmann in 1:44, pinned Zach Gomes of Mayville in 2:47, beat Cass City’s Nick Adkins by default and lost to Bad Axe’s Jacob Taylor, 15-10.
Bentley’s Chance Wegner was runner up at 145 lbs. after losing to Aaron Bauman of New Lothrop, 3-2, in the finals. Nick Haywood also qualified for regionals at 152 lbs. taking fourth in the district.
Bendle and Bentley will travel to New Lothrop on Saturday to participate in regional No. 14-4.
